It’s a Techtime special as Trumpets is joined by Matthew Somerfield, technical editor at Motorsport.Com as they dig out the details that made the difference in the second half of the season. From technical directives to fatal flaws, from development disasters to convenient convergence, no floor fence or sidepod ramp goes unnoticed in this, the latest episode of Missed Apex Podcast.Please consider supporting us on patreon.
